The Mountain Island, located in the southwest corner of the biome, extends 110 meters into the air above the sea level, featuring many underwater Mountains Caves that can be both entered from the underwater entrance or directly on the island's shore. These leviathans can discourage the player from going deeper into the biome, where the best fragments and areas are. At least one can be found near the island bordering the Mushroom Forest. The Mountains are characterized by a variety of huge rocky mountain ranges, sometimes with hydrothermal vents on them - Magnetite is typically found around these.Įxtreme caution should be taken while exploring the Mountains, as it is home to seven Reaper Leviathans.
